Hi,
The inside handle to open the sliding door seems to have stuck in the pulled back position rather than popping back. Can't now open the sliding door from the inside. The door opens from the outside and the central locking seems ok. Any ideas?

Just thought I’d share my experience of exactly this problem. Removed the interior panel etc. to access the lock mechanism. Removed and opened up the mechanism. Inside, found that there is a plastic clip (https://m.aliexpress.com/item/40000...MI6eX7mYe59QIVGO7tCh3-dga-EAQYAiABEgINofD_BwE) that holds in place a rod that pulls the internal plate that pulls the cable to release the latch at the rear of the sliding door. The plastic clip had failed and so the rod had popped out of its hole in the plate. I didn’t have any of the clips, as shown at the link, so swapped the failed one (still good enough to just swivel at the point where the vertical bar attached to the interior handle enters the locking mechanism) for the good one that just swivels. All now works again. Hopefully, it’ll hold for a good while. A few hours work but a 10 pence fix rather than a likely £500 bill from VW.
